The bar chart illustrates the proportion of snowfall at three ski resorts, namely Viking Moutain, Snowbury, and Power Peak in Canada between November and December.
Overall, the amount of snowfall in Viking mountain and Snowbury increase over the period shown. While Power Peak shows a steady decline in its figures.
As can be seen from the chart, in Viking mountain, the snowfall accounts for the lowest with over 8 centimetres in November then go up minimally around 12 centimetres in December. The proportion of snowfall in Snowbury in November is two times higher than that of Viking mountain, at around 18 centimetres, and hit the highest of snowfall in December.
In contrast to Powder Peak, the snowfall lead the way with over 38 centimetres in November, however, a two-month period witnesses a decrease of 20 centimetres in the amount of snowfall.
